/** * Execute the query as a "select" statement. * * @param array $columns * @return array|static[] */ public function get($columns = array('*')) { if (!is_null($this->cacheMinutes)) { return $this->getCached($columns); } return parent::get($columns); }
/** * Begin a fluent query against a database collection. * * @param string $collection * @return QueryBuilder */ public function collection($collection) { $processor = $this->getPostProcessor(); $query = new Query\Builder($this, $processor); return $query->from($collection); }
/** * Begin a fluent query against a database collection. * * @param string $collection * @return QueryBuilder */ public function collection($collection) { $query = new QueryBuilder($this); return $query->from($collection); }